About Oakwood

Oakwood is a suburb located in West Yorkshire, England, within the LS8 postcode area. It is primarily a residential area, featuring a mix of housing styles, including Victorian and modern properties. The suburb is well-served by local amenities, including shops, schools, and parks, making it a convenient place for families and individuals alike.

The area is also known for its green spaces, with Oakwood Park providing a pleasant environment for outdoor activities. Public transport links connect Oakwood to nearby towns and cities, ensuring easy access to the wider region. Overall, Oakwood offers a practical and community-focused living experience for its residents.

Household Income in Oakwood ONS 2023

The average total household income in Oakwood is approximately £52,535 a year before tax, 5%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£40,088.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Oakwood ONS 2025

There are approximately 1,562 active businesses based in Oakwood, around 30 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 92%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 2 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Oakwood

Of the 19,270 households in and around Oakwood, 56% are owned, 18% are socially rented and 25% are privately rented. Home ownership here is lower than the England and Wales average of 63%.

Owned 56% Social rented 18% Private rented 25%

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Oakwood.
